MI Team Full Overview
| Category | Details |
| Captain | Hardik Pandya |
| Head Coach | Mark Boucher |
| Home Ground | Wankhede Stadium, Mumbai |
| IPL Titles | 5 (2013, 2015, 2017, 2019, 2020) |
| Owner | Reliance Industries |
| Established | 2008 |
Mumbai Indians play their home matches at the iconic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ai. The franchise is owned by Reliance Industries and has built a reputation for maintaining a strong squad with experienced international players and talented Indian cricket players.
MI Squad 2026 | Mumbai Indians Players
Below is the updated Mumbai Indians squad for IPL 2026 based on player retentions and auction additions.
| No. | Player Name | Role | Category |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Hardik Pandya | All-Rounder | Captain |
| 2 | Rohit Sharma | Batter | Indian |
| 3 | Suryakumar Yadav | Batter | Indian |
| 4 | Tilak Varma | Batter | Indian |
| 5 | Robin Minz | Wicketkeeper-Batter | Indian |
| 6 | Ryan Rickelton | Wicketkeeper-Batter | Overseas |
| 7 | Quinton de Kock | Wicketkeeper-Batter | Overseas |
| 8 | Danish Malewar | Batter | Indian |
| 9 | Sherfane Rutherford | Batter | Overseas |
| 10 | Naman Dhir | All-Rounder | Indian |
| 11 | Mitchell Santner | All-Rounder | Overseas |
| 12 | Raj Angad Bawa | All-Rounder | Indian |
| 13 | Atharva Ankolekar | All-Rounder | Indian |
| 14 | Mayank Rawat | All-Rounder | Indian |
| 15 | Corbin Bosch | All-Rounder | Overseas |
| 16 | Will Jacks | All-Rounder | Overseas |
| 17 | Shardul Thakur | All-Rounder | Indian |
| 18 | Jasprit Bumrah | Bowler | Indian |
| 19 | Trent Boult | Bowler | Overseas |
| 20 | Deepak Chahar | Bowler | Indian |
| 21 | Mayank Markande | Bowler | Indian |
| 22 | Ashwani Kumar | Bowler | Indian |
| 23 | Raghu Sharma | Bowler | Indian |
| 24 | Mohammad Izhar | Bowler | Indian |
| 25 | Allah Ghazanfar | Bowler | Overseas |
The Mumbai Indians squad for IPL 2026 includes a powerful batting lineup led by Rohit Sharma and Suryakumar Yadav, along with an experienced bowling attack headed by Jasprit Bumrah. The presence of strong all-rounders like Hardik Pandya provides additional balance to the team.
MI Released Players 2026
Before the IPL 2026 season, the Mumbai Indians released several players as part of their auction strategy and squad restructuring.
| No. | Player Name | Country | Role |
| 1 | Tim David | Australia | Batter |
| 2 | Romario Shepherd | West Indies | All-rounder |
| 3 | Gerald Coetzee | South Africa | Fast Bowler |
| 4 | Shams Mulani | India | All-rounder |
| 5 | Kumar Kartikeya | India | Spinner |
| 6 | Arjun Tendulkar | India | Fast Bowler |
| 7 | Dewald Brevis | South Africa | Batter |
These changes helped the franchise manage its budget and bring new talent into the squad for the upcoming season.

Rise, Dominance & Early Heartbreaks
The Mumbai Indians had a healthy-looking squad in the early years of IPL but failed to put them in winning positions for championships. They entered the playoffs multiple times but bowed out of the knockout games.
The tide completely turned in 2013 when Rohit Sharma became captain of the team and led them to their maiden IPL trophy. This was the beginning of a golden period for the Mumbai Indians.
Thrillers, Resurgence & Highs and Lows
They went on to dominate the IPL for a number of years after they won their first title in 2013. They won the championships in 2015, 2017, 2019 and 2020. The team added more trophies to their collection

Updated MI Performance Table (Including 2025)
| Season | Matches | Wins | Losses | Final Standing | Top Run Scorer | Top Wicket Taker |
| 2013 | 19 | 13 | 6 | Champions | Rohit Sharma | Harbhajan Singh |
| 2015 | 16 | 10 | 6 | Champions | Lendl Simmons | Lasith Malinga |
| 2017 | 17 | 12 | 5 | Champions | Parthiv Patel | Jasprit Bumrah |
| 2019 | 16 | 11 | 5 | Champions | Quinton de Kock | Jasprit Bumrah |
| 2020 | 16 | 11 | 5 | Champions | Ishan Kishan | Jasprit Bumrah |
| 2023 | 16 | 9 | 7 | Playoffs | Suryakumar Yadav | Piyush Chawla |
| 2025 | 14 | 7 | 7 | League Stage | Suryakumar Yadav | Jasprit Bumrah |
